INTRODUCTION: Neurological involvement in immunoglobulin G4-related disease (IgG4-RD) is increasingly recognized. Its diagnosis can be challenging due to clinical mimics and difficulty in obtaining nervous system biopsies. The aim of this study was to describe a cohort of neurological IgG4-RD patients. METHODS: Patients were recruited from a neuroimmunology tertiary center. Clinical, laboratory, neuroimaging and histological data were reviewed. RESULTS: Fifteen patients (60% women), with a median age of 53 years (48.5 - 65.0) were included: 13 (86.7%) classified as possible IgG4-RD, one (6.7%) as probable and one (6.7%) as definitive. The most common neurological phenotypes were meningoencephalitis (26.7%), orbital pseudotumor (13.3%), cranial neuropathies (13.3%), peripheral neuropathy (13.3%), and longitudinally extensive transverse myelitis (LTEM) (13.3%). Median serum IgG4 concentration was 191.5 (145.0 - 212.0) mg/dL. Seven in 14 patients had CSF pleocytosis (50.0%) and oligoclonal bands restricted to the intrathecal compartment, while most cases presented elevated CSF proteins (64.3%). Magnetic resonance imaging abnormalities included white matter lesions in four (26.7%), hypertrophic pachymeningitis in two (13.3%), and LETM in two (13.3%). Two patients had biopsy-proven IgG4-RD in extra-neurological sites. CONCLUSION: This study highlights the phenotypical variability of the neurological IgG4-RD. Biopsy inaccessibility reinforces the importance of new criteria for the diagnosis of this subset of patients.

OBJECTIVE: Our objective was to study the relationship between epilepsy and autoimmune diseases in two different types of epilepsy: idiopathic generalized epilepsies (IGEs) and mesial temporal lobe epilepsy with hippocampal sclerosis (MTLE-HS). The contribution of the human leukocyte antigen (HLA) system to this relationship was analyzed. METHODS: Adult patients with IGEs and MTLE-HS at a tertiary epilepsy center were consecutively enrolled between January 2016 and December 2020. RESULTS: A total of 664 patients, 422 with IGEs and 242 with MTLE-HS, were included. Patients with IGEs were 15 years younger, on average, than patients with MTLE-HS (p < .001). The frequency of autoimmune diseases was 5.5% (n = 23) and 4.5% (n = 11) in patients with IGEs and MTLE-HS, respectively (p = .716). The mean age of autoimmune disease onset was 20 ± 15.6 years in patients with IGEs and 36.7 ± 16.5 years in patients with MTLE-HS (p < .05). Clinical manifestations of autoimmune diseases preceded epilepsy onset in 30.4% of patients with IGEs (i.e., in early childhood); in the other patients, epilepsy appeared before autoimmune disease onset. In all but one patient with MTLE-HS and autoimmune diseases, the autoimmune diseases appeared after epilepsy onset from adolescence onward. SIGNIFICANCE: Our study indicates two relationship patterns: a bidirectional association between IGEs and autoimmune diseases and a unidirectional relationship between MTLE-HS and autoimmune diseases. The involvement of genetic susceptibility factors (such as the HLA system), autoinflammatory mechanisms, female sex, and antiseizure medications in these relationships are discussed.

Background: Friedreich ataxia (FA) is the most common form of autosomal recessive (AR) ataxia. It is a rare disease, but carriers are frequent (1/100). Pseudodominance in FA has seldomly been reported; it may pose additional challenges for diagnosis. Cases: A family with two consecutive generations affected by FA is described. The proband and two younger siblings had typical FA, characterized by infantile-onset ataxia, hyporeflexia, Babinski sign, cardiomyopathy, and loss of ambulation in the second decade of life. Another female sibling had delayed-onset (>25 years old), with mild cerebellar and sensitive ataxia since her mid-30s. Their father presented very late-onset FA (>40 years old), with sensitive axonal neuropathy. All five patients had biallelic (GAA)n expansion in FXN. The first three had larger expansions (>800 repeats), while the latter two had one shorter expanded allele (~90 repeats). Literature Review: Pseudodominant inheritance has been described in 13 neurological disorders. Seven are movement disorders, of which three were associated with high frequency of carriers (FA, Wilson's disease and PRKN-related parkinsonism). Conclusions: Clinicians should be aware of the possibility of pseudodominance when facing an apparent autosomal dominant pedigree, particularly in disorders with high frequency of carriers and variable expression. Otherwise, genetic diagnoses may be delayed.

Background: Corticobasal degeneration (CBD) may have a rapidly progressive (RP) clinical course, mimicking other neurological conditions. Objectives: To describe a neuropathologically proven case of RP-CBD in a patient initially diagnosed with immune-mediated brainstem encephalitis. Methods: Retrospective data collection from electronic records and authorized video material. Results: A 51-year-old man presented with bilateral ptosis, diplopia, and dysphagia. The diagnostic workup was negative for myasthenic syndromes. He progressively developed cognitive dysfunction with frontal release signs and asymmetric parkinsonism. Cerebrospinal fluid evaluation revealed 4 leukocytes/uL, 0.32 g/L proteins, 0.85 g/L glucose, and absent oligoclonal bands. Weakly positive anti-PNMA2 (Ma2/Ta) antibodies were present, and magnetic resonance imaging showed a T2 hyperintensity involving the midbrain and pons. Based on these features, the diagnosis of immune-mediated brainstem encephalitis was considered. The patient did not improve after several cycles of methylprednisolone, intravenous immunoglobulin, and plasma exchange. At 1 year after onset, he developed horizontal and vertical gaze limitation and worsening of the parkinsonism and cognitive dysfunction. By age 53, he was severely disabled, requiring percutaneous gastrostomy for feeding. Anti-IgLON5 was negative. He fulfilled the clinical criteria for probable progressive supranuclear palsy. He died from pneumonia at age 54. The neuropathological examination revealed a 4-repeat tauopathy with features of CBD with extensive involvement of the brainstem. Conclusions: RP-CBD may resemble brainstem encephalitis. The severity of brainstem and upper spinal cord pathology in the postmortem examination correlated with the clinical and imaging features.

Peripheral neuropathy is a common problem in patients with Parkinson's disease. Peripheral neuropathy's prevalence in Parkinson's disease varies between 4.8-55%, compared with 9% in the general population. It remains unclear whether peripheral neuropathy leads to decreased motor performance in Parkinson's disease, resulting in impaired mobility and increased balance deficits. We aimed to determine the prevalence and type of peripheral neuropathy in Parkinson's disease patients and evaluate its functional impact on gait and balance. A cohort of consecutive Parkinson's disease patients assessed by movement disorders specialists based on the UK Brain Bank criteria underwent clinical, neurophysiological (nerve conduction studies and quantitative sensory testing) and neuropathological (intraepidermal nerve fibre density in skin biopsy punches) evaluation to characterize the peripheral neuropathy type and aetiology using a cross-sectional design. Gait and balance were characterized using wearable health-technology in OFF and ON medication states, and the main parameters were extracted using validated algorithms. A total of 99 Parkinson's disease participants with a mean age of 67.2 (±10) years and mean disease duration of 6.5 (±5) years were assessed. Based on a comprehensive clinical, neurophysiological and neuropathological evaluation, we found that 40.4% of Parkinson's disease patients presented peripheral neuropathy, with a predominance of small fibre neuropathy (70% of the group). In the OFF state, the presence of peripheral neuropathy was significantly associated with shorter stride length (P = 0.029), slower gait speed (P = 0.005) and smaller toe-off angles (P = 0.002) during straight walking; significantly slower speed (P = 0.019) and smaller toe-off angles (P = 0.007) were also observed during circular walking. In the ON state, the above effects remained, albeit moderately reduced. With regard to balance, significant differences between Parkinson's disease patients with and without peripheral neuropathy were observed in the OFF medication state during stance with closed eyes on a foam surface. In the ON states, these differences were no longer observable. We showed that peripheral neuropathy is common in Parkinson's disease and influences gait and balance parameters, as measured with mobile health-technology. Our study supports that peripheral neuropathy recognition and directed treatment should be pursued in order to improve gait in Parkinson's disease patients and minimize balance-related disability, targeting individualized medical care.

Introduction: There is a complex interplay between systemic autoimmunity, immunosuppression, and infections. Any or all of these can result in neurologic manifestations, requiring diligence on the part of neurologists. Case report: We herein report a case of a patient on immunosuppressive treatment for a vasculitis that resulted in zoster meningoencephalitis. This was further complicated by the development of anti-NMDAr encephalitis, the etiology of which is undetermined and further discussed in this paper. The patient eventually developed COVID-19 during hospitalization, succumbing to the respiratory infection. Conclusion: This case emphasizes that post-infectious autoimmune disorders are becoming increasingly recognized and that they should still be considered in patients who are on immunosuppression. Practitioners should be aware of the complex relationship between autoimmunity and immunosuppression and consider both throughout the disease course.

Despite the existence of well-established diagnostic criteria for autoimmune encephalitis, there are diseases capable of mimicking it. This study sought to retrospectively evaluate the reasons for testing and the final diagnosis of patients admitted to a Neurology ward tested for anti-NMDAR antibodies and estimate sensitivity and specificity of current diagnostic criteria. The threshold for testing was lower than that of the prevailing diagnostic criteria, and the proportion of autoimmune encephalitis mimics was high. Searching for alternative diagnoses is of pivotal importance in cases of autoimmune encephalitis suspicion, and diagnostic criteria may need expanding so that no autoimmune encephalitis is missed.

Hereditary cerebellar ataxias comprise a heterogeneous group of neurodegenerative disorders affecting the cerebellum and/or cerebellar pathways. Next-generation sequencing techniques have contributed substantially to the expansion of ataxia-causing genes, including genes classically described in alternative phenotypes. Herein, we describe a patient with adult-onset cerebellar ataxia, minor dystonia, neuropathy, seizure and ophthalmological pathology, who bears a novel variant in KMT2B (NM_014727.2:c.3334 + 1G > A). Bioinformatic analysis suggested this variant completely abolished the splice-site at exon 8/intron 8, which was confirmed through analysis of mRNA extracted from fibroblasts. Exon 8 skipping would ultimately translate as an in-frame deletion at the protein level, corresponding to the loss of 91 aminoacids [p.(Gly1020_Asn1111del)]. So far, KMT2B disease causing variants have been described in patients with dystonia or neurodevelopmental delay, with no reports of a cerebellar predominant phenotype. Our findings highlight the possible role of KMT2B as a gene involved in hereditary cerebellar ataxias.

BACKGROUND: Friedreich ataxia is the most frequent hereditary ataxia worldwide. Subclinical visual and auditory involvement has been recognized in these patients, with co-occurrence of severe blindness and deafness being rare. CASE REPORT: We describe a patient, homozygous for a 873 GAA expansion in the FXN gene, whose first symptoms appeared by the age of 8. At 22 years-old he developed sensorineural deafness, and at 26 visual impairment. Deafness had a progressive course over 11 years, until a stage of extreme severity which hindered communication. Visual acuity had a catastrophic deterioration, with blindness 3 years after visual impairment was first noticed. Audiograms documented progressive sensorineural deafness, most striking for low frequencies. Visual evoked potentials disclosed bilaterally increased P100 latency. He passed away at the age of 41 years old, at a stage of extreme disability, blind and deaf, in addition to the complete phenotype of a patient with Friedreich ataxia of more than 30 years duration. DISCUSSION: Severe vision loss and extreme deafness has been described in very few patients with Friedreich ataxia. Long duration, severe disease and large expanded alleles may account for such an extreme phenotype; nonetheless, the role of factors as modifying genes warrants further investigation in this subset of patients.

Congenital ataxias are a heterogeneous group of disorders characterized by congenital or early-onset ataxia. Here, we describe two siblings with congenital ataxia, who acquired independent gait by age 4 years. After 16 years of follow-up they presented near normal cognition, cerebellar ataxia, mild pyramidal signs, and dystonia. On exome sequencing, a novel homozygous variant (c.1580-18C > G - intron 17) in ATP8A2 was identified. A new acceptor splice site was predicted by bioinformatics tools, and functionally characterized through a minigene assay. Minigene constructs were generated by PCR-amplification of genomic sequences surrounding the variant of interest and cloning into the pCMVdi vector. Altered splicing was evaluated by expressing these constructs in HEK293T cells. The construct with the c.1580-18C > G homozygous variant produced an aberrant transcript, leading to retention of 17 bp of intron 17, by the use of an alternative acceptor splice site, resulting in a premature stop codon by insertion of four amino acids. These results allowed us to establish this as a disease-causing variant and expand ATP8A2-related disorders to include less severe forms of congenital ataxia.

Cerebellar ataxia with neuropathy and vestibular areflexia syndrome (CANVAS) is a late-onset, multisystem ataxia that remained only clinically defined, until recently, when the discovery of biallelic repeat expansion in the RFC1 gene allowed the genetic link. We describe the first Portuguese familial CANVAS harboring the pathogenic RFC1 expansion. Detail clinical features and course of four affected members are provided. Phenotype characterizations are important as the novel RFC1 mutation is expected to be a major cause of idiopathic late-onset ataxia.

Allergic contact dermatitis (ACD) is a type IV, delayed-type reaction caused by skin contact with low-molecular-weight organic chemicals and metal ions that activate antigen-specific T cells, primarily T-helper 1 (Th1), in a sensitized individual, leading to skin eczema.First-line treatments are based on avoidance of causal agents and topical corticosteroids/immunomodulators. In recalcitrant cases, chronic oral immunosuppressive agents may be used, but they may have serious adverse effects and do not address the immunological disfunction. We report a case of severe ACD, unresponsive to topical or oral immunosuppressive therapy, which resolved itself after treatment with teriflunomide (TF) 14 mg/daily used for multiple sclerosis. TF is a once-daily, oral selective and reversible dihydroorotate dehydrogenase inhibitor, revealing a new treatment option for ACD.

BACKGROUND: Short-lasting unilateral neuralgiform headaches include those with conjunctival injection and tearing and with cranial autonomic symptoms. Most frequently reported as idiopathic, there is a growing number of symptomatic cases described. CASE REPORT: A 57-year old man presented a 16-year history of right hemifacial short-lasting pain attacks accompanied by ipsilateral autonomic symptoms and simultaneous malar contractions. Brain MRI disclosed a right acoustic neuroma compressing the right facial nerve and a venous developmental anomaly perpendicular to the right facial nerve root entry zone, without lesions affecting the trigeminal nerve. He was started on lamotrigine, resulting in complete remission of pain attacks, autonomic signs and facial contractions. CONCLUSIONS: This patient presents a typical short-lasting unilateral neuralgiform headache with response to lamotrigine. The uniqueness of the case is the co-occurring malar contractions, evocative of facial nerve involvement. We speculate whether facial nerve compression renders this nerve more susceptible to triggering during a short-lasting unilateral neuralgiform headache attack.
